Class: ActionCable::SubscriptionAdapter::Async::AsyncSubscriberMap
| Relationships & Source Files | |
| Super Chains via Extension / Inclusion / Inheritance | |
| Class Chain: | |
| Instance Chain: | |
| Inherits: | ActionCable::SubscriptionAdapter::SubscriberMap 
 | 
| Defined in: | actioncable/lib/action_cable/subscription_adapter/async.rb | 
Class Method Summary
- .new(event_loop) ⇒ AsyncSubscriberMap constructor
::ActionCable::SubscriptionAdapter::SubscriberMap - Inherited
Instance Method Summary
Constructor Details
    .new(event_loop)  ⇒ AsyncSubscriberMap 
  
# File 'actioncable/lib/action_cable/subscription_adapter/async.rb', line 14
def initialize(event_loop) @event_loop = event_loop super() end
Instance Method Details
#add_subscriber
[ GitHub ]# File 'actioncable/lib/action_cable/subscription_adapter/async.rb', line 19
def add_subscriber(*) @event_loop.post { super } end
#invoke_callback
[ GitHub ]# File 'actioncable/lib/action_cable/subscription_adapter/async.rb', line 23
def invoke_callback(*) @event_loop.post { super } end